2. Core skills for hanging clothes in small spaces
1.vertical space development: The latest research shows that using wall space above 1.8 meters can increase storage capacity by 40%. It is recommended to use a ceiling-mounted stand with slide rails to take into account both load-bearing and aesthetics.
2.seasonal rotation system: The recently popular "capsule wardrobe" concept suggests hanging current-season clothes and compressing and storing out-of-season clothes. Data shows that this method can save 35% space.
3.Multifunctional accessories application: Popular product data shows that the following accessories are most popular for small apartments:
| Accessory type | Usage scenarios | space saving effect |
|---|---|---|
| S-shaped multi-layer trouser rack | Pants/scarf storage | Increase vertical utilization by 60% |
| swivel hook | Behind door/corner location | Develop 8-15 hanging points |
| No punching telescopic pole | Temporary drying area | Create 1.2 meters of hanging space |

5. Guide to avoid pitfalls
| Common misunderstandings | scientific solution |
|---|---|
| Blindly increase the number of hooks | Scientifically distributed according to 1 piece/3cm spacing |
| Ignore load limits | Each linear meter of hanging rod shall not exceed 15kg |
| mixed mediasuspended | Partition management (separate silk/denim) |
